In the fast-paced world of marketing and advertising, packaging print plays a crucial role in capturing the attention of consumers and driving brand awareness. Packaging serves as the first point of contact between a product and a potential customer, making it essential for businesses to prioritize the design and print quality of their packaging materials.
packaging print refers to the design, production, and printing of packaging materials such as boxes, labels, and wrappers. These materials not only protect the product inside but also serve as a powerful marketing tool that can influence purchasing decisions. In a competitive market where brands are constantly vying for consumer attention, innovative and eye-catching packaging print can make all the difference.
One of the primary functions of packaging print is to convey information about the product to the consumer. This includes details such as the product name, ingredients, expiration date, and any other relevant information. Clear and legible packaging print is essential in ensuring that consumers can make informed decisions about the products they are purchasing. In addition, well-designed packaging can also communicate a brand’s values, personality, and quality standards, helping to build brand loyalty among consumers.
packaging print also plays a significant role in differentiating a product from its competitors. In a crowded marketplace where similar products abound, unique and visually appealing packaging can help a product stand out on the shelf. Bold colors, creative graphics, and engaging typography can draw the consumer’s eye and create a memorable impression. packaging print that is cohesive with a brand’s overall aesthetic can also help to reinforce brand recognition and identity.
Another important aspect of packaging print is its ability to evoke emotions and create a connection with consumers. Studies have shown that consumers are more likely to make a purchase based on emotional responses rather than rational considerations. Packaging print that triggers positive emotions, such as joy, nostalgia, or excitement, can create a lasting impression and drive brand affinity. By leveraging the power of color, imagery, and design, businesses can create packaging that resonates with their target audience on a deeper level.
In addition to its marketing and branding benefits, packaging print also serves practical purposes. Durable and well-crafted packaging materials can protect products from damage during transit and storage, ensuring that they reach consumers in optimal condition. Properly designed packaging can also enhance the user experience by making it easy for consumers to access and use the product. Functional and user-friendly packaging can contribute to positive brand experiences and encourage repeat purchases.
The rise of e-commerce has further underscored the importance of packaging print in the marketing industry. With more consumers shopping online, packaging has become a key touchpoint for brands to engage with their customers. In a virtual setting where physical interaction is limited, packaging print serves as a tangible representation of the brand and product, creating a memorable and immersive shopping experience. Brands that invest in high-quality and visually appealing packaging print can make a lasting impression on consumers and drive brand loyalty in the digital landscape.
As technology continues to advance, packaging print has also evolved to incorporate digital and interactive elements. Augmented reality, QR codes, and personalized packaging are just a few examples of how brands are leveraging technology to enhance the packaging experience. These innovations not only create engaging and memorable experiences for consumers but also provide valuable data and insights for brands to optimize their marketing strategies.
